I ordered a plate of sausages with fries and a beer. And this is what I got.

I swiftly got rid of the green stuff and taste the beer. Konig Ludwig Hell is an excellent beer. Blonde with a white lasting head. Strong smell and strong taste, with a sweet bitterness in the end.

Now let’s see the sausages… First one the Spicey Knacker Sausage. Indeed it had a lot of spices. It was boiled, tender and fluffy. The spices were dominating the flavor. The thing I didn’t like was the thing that covers the sausages that was difficult to eat.

On to the Bavarian Weisswurst. It was boiled and looked and tasted like a hot dog, but it was meatier and saltier, which I am not a fan of. It seeded too processed but I guess you expect that from a food like this.

The next two sausages were grilled. The one I liked the most was the Berliner Bockwurst. You ate it and you could understand that you ate meat. As fatty as needed and as spiced as needed, too. They look like a kind of sausage that we make here in Greece and call them Choriatika ( made at the village ) but thinner. They were great.

The Nurnberger Sausages were equally excellent. The taste was like the first one but they were way smaller. A bit- size sausages. Less meaty but more fluffy with a unique taste.

And I almost forgot. I got another beer. One is like none. It was a Radeberger Pilsner. More blonde and with a longer white head. Refreshing and easy to drink with a strong bitter taste that nearly covers everything else. I liked more the first one.
